From nobody Sun May 12 10:02:44 2024 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4VcdTd0MDlz5JDWW; Sun, 12 May 2024 10:02:45 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4VcdTc5vXTz4r07; Sun, 12 May 2024 10:02:44 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1715508164;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=1Eu07vBk9jfW3X9Tn1VN/8oUpTzwO/lVp8EmO1S7FyU=; b=xhNhqtMXdcqhn3a8DRmvFoWN7LflpryjrdVEKIlSJB5CO0llpkIVYILoepjzewbdXCF6ek 5bLExBut584jLvjuT3ypr+vnYKAMB4ZhzsKdb7PKjyfcpvGeVJrxcvzaacYIOn5/t5r1bO ST8VJpqsPka+5SOWiRGPGpHpzZzkKL783QLKNROvpmBDV30Ees7JBZWbZbwVJIfpq6/1+6 N6KBFGD5TBXAEfJ7ByN3i9bbrAbEVlqpDSFfRIPXFAxXKb7Etk+Li+fxSAouxhaZcN39Zs CRlz4GFzi+ibdEe05OZTszfPfT2LLFrO8v22VyUsEhJElqT+4r91PWxb1zzeHQ==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1715508164; a=rsa-sha256; cv=none; b=lld4uLNCrckkKi5KcqT5O7l8R6Wo2pHtSTIph3zXx2cK0Wc4h7yVS84A6o2sAROsC25dc1 dYl+2yrJp2A0uPMg8IzTUyiE1JKoZTLL74OtLZKq1sY+sliwTz4wd084261+LJ192FrvzI u30A2PGSHLNicUisiuU09HKJex70ddce5IyEROhAhS0yOI6Bor982VzNqvzrt+TfazbmgV fxefmIe+n6lHYjOVcJBYanV8SDMiabx2hsUOhSMSYvx2NDgesHZ46KMQgdAJhq76FYweCW V/pOa5WwtKGZ5li2Mk8GmwwQrZfZrk1Qy2uSJz+NWVXfpdFQSXd+e7pswQiJYA==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1715508164;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=1Eu07vBk9jfW3X9Tn1VN/8oUpTzwO/lVp8EmO1S7FyU=; b=NWs+B2m3QwXbO/csmNejets/lRSr0YUxedra7M6Us2lx5ebA8vKj7PVhmQZVDIbZhFQ9EE gItHbwVxpJ818pSetDBitPinFMREFi4gNyYUZz+jhu2CYFA645fWr6dFNmvRQNaLHSy7M1 OWHSD67qg5RquQZM2jCKTKV3niYsRsCUHucFUCyOuoopeQcOMw2ouJfkfqOECBLuIyTwcN TmI8lJ/hjZSc7d46M2cBSaFTbtMB8H8G0mVi+Bjgfice6Gi+2YHZZkJ+Kk3Z/x/KbaJpiG 213KMHFz6VdWpjCkxZRRvtQCtI4WxM52mYSP+nvrq0AaIwk1PjERE0Gnk7p4xA==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4VcdTc5V4bz10rP; Sun, 12 May 2024 10:02:44 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.17.1/8.17.1) with ESMTP id 44CA2iUj017111; Sun, 12 May 2024 10:02:44 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.17.1/8.17.1/Submit) id 44CA2iEU017108; Sun, 12 May 2024 10:02:44 GMT (envelope-from git) Date: Sun, 12 May 2024 10:02:44 GMT Message-Id: <202405121002.44CA2iEU017108@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Gleb Popov Subject: git: 9db3b5c7bafe - main - devel/linux-rl9-strace: add strace from Rocky Linux List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: dev-commits-ports-main@freebsd.org Sender: owner-dev-commits-ports-main@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: arrowd X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 9db3b5c7bafe3d642fe8501838eef16253e4280b Auto-Submitted: auto-generated The branch main has been updated by arrowd: URL: https://cgit.FreeBSD.org/ports/commit/?id=9db3b5c7bafe3d642fe8501838eef16253e4280b commit 9db3b5c7bafe3d642fe8501838eef16253e4280b Author: Dima Panov AuthorDate: 2024-02-05 07:48:23 +0000 Commit: Gleb Popov CommitDate: 2024-05-12 10:01:18 +0000 devel/linux-rl9-strace: add strace from Rocky Linux Co-authored-by: Gleb Popov Sponsored by: Serenity Cybersecurity, LLC --- Mk/Uses/linux.mk | 1 + devel/Makefile | 1 + devel/linux-rl9-strace/Makefile | 21 +++++++++++++++++++++ devel/linux-rl9-strace/distinfo | 7 +++++++ devel/linux-rl9-strace/pkg-descr | 8 ++++++++ devel/linux-rl9-strace/pkg-plist.amd64 | 11 +++++++++++ 6 files changed, 49 insertions(+) diff --git a/Mk/Uses/linux.mk b/Mk/Uses/linux.mk index f4038650cc06..bf606879f532 100644 --- a/Mk/Uses/linux.mk +++ b/Mk/Uses/linux.mk @@ -150,6 +150,7 @@ _linux_${linux_ARGS}_sdlimage= linux-${linux_ARGS}-sdl_image>0:graphics/linux-$ _linux_${linux_ARGS}_sdlmixer= linux-${linux_ARGS}-sdl_mixer>0:audio/linux-${linux_ARGS}-sdl_mixer _linux_${linux_ARGS}_sdlttf= linux-${linux_ARGS}-sdl_ttf>0:graphics/linux-${linux_ARGS}-sdl_ttf _linux_${linux_ARGS}_sqlite3= linux-${linux_ARGS}-sqlite>0:databases/linux-${linux_ARGS}-sqlite3 +_linux_${linux_ARGS}_strace= linux-${linux_ARGS}-strace>0:devel/linux-${linux_ARGS}-strace _linux_${linux_ARGS}_systemd-libs= linux-${linux_ARGS}-systemd-libs>0:devel/linux-${linux_ARGS}-systemd-libs _linux_${linux_ARGS}_tcl85= linux-${linux_ARGS}-tcl85>0:lang/linux-${linux_ARGS}-tcl85 _linux_${linux_ARGS}_tcp_wrappers-libs= linux-${linux_ARGS}-tcp_wrappers-libs>0:net/linux-${linux_ARGS}-tcp_wrappers-libs diff --git a/devel/Makefile b/devel/Makefile index d1d0bdbf87af..6891521813bc 100644 --- a/devel/Makefile +++ b/devel/Makefile @@ -1512,6 +1512,7 @@ SUBDIR += linux-rl9-libunistring SUBDIR += linux-rl9-llvm SUBDIR += linux-rl9-nspr + SUBDIR += linux-rl9-strace SUBDIR += linux-rl9-systemd-libs SUBDIR += linux-sublime-merge SUBDIR += linux_libusb diff --git a/devel/linux-rl9-strace/Makefile b/devel/linux-rl9-strace/Makefile new file mode 100644 index 000000000000..6c6f8276dc75 --- /dev/null +++ b/devel/linux-rl9-strace/Makefile @@ -0,0 +1,21 @@ +PORTNAME= strace +PORTVERSION= 5.18 +DISTVERSIONSUFFIX= -2.el9 +CATEGORIES= devel + +MAINTAINER= emulation@FreeBSD.org +COMMENT= System call tracer (Rocky Linux ${LINUX_DIST_VER}) +WWW= https://sourceforge.net/projects/strace/ + +USES= cpe linux:rl9 +USE_LINUX= elfutils-libs +USE_LINUX_RPM= nolib + +CPE_VENDOR= strace_project + +CONFLICTS= linux-c7-${PORTNAME} +DOCSDIR= ${PREFIX}/usr/share/doc/${PORTNAME}${PKGNAMESUFFIX} + +OPTIONS_DEFINE= DOCS + +.include diff --git a/devel/linux-rl9-strace/distinfo b/devel/linux-rl9-strace/distinfo new file mode 100644 index 000000000000..d0e98d76e42f --- /dev/null +++ b/devel/linux-rl9-strace/distinfo @@ -0,0 +1,7 @@ +TIMESTAMP = 1706860420 +SHA256 (rocky/s/strace-5.18-2.el9.aarch64.rpm) = 09f70a66adcea1e3778ccf07f41d8dfedb365c1dfa2b5eb50810d39f07525507 +SIZE (rocky/s/strace-5.18-2.el9.aarch64.rpm) = 1368782 +SHA256 (rocky/s/strace-5.18-2.el9.x86_64.rpm) = f189da0f9d11a954f2e2828f50580fd8a1c72a9d086d984523734b6e230177d1 +SIZE (rocky/s/strace-5.18-2.el9.x86_64.rpm) = 1428127 +SHA256 (rocky/s/strace-5.18-2.el9.src.rpm) = 5e461fe9b700d4825a9a16b551d408bdbb838b71bea152143e3009d2c5944803 +SIZE (rocky/s/strace-5.18-2.el9.src.rpm) = 2342957 diff --git a/devel/linux-rl9-strace/pkg-descr b/devel/linux-rl9-strace/pkg-descr new file mode 100644 index 000000000000..b643d61c2dbc --- /dev/null +++ b/devel/linux-rl9-strace/pkg-descr @@ -0,0 +1,8 @@ +strace is a system call tracer, i.e. a debugging tool which prints out a trace +of all the system calls made by a another process/program. + +strace is similar to the native BSD ``truss'' utility, but it's output style is +more convenient in most cases. + +For strace to work, linprocfs has to be mounted. FreeBSD does not mount it by +default. For more information, man linprocfs. diff --git a/devel/linux-rl9-strace/pkg-plist.amd64 b/devel/linux-rl9-strace/pkg-plist.amd64 new file mode 100644 index 000000000000..9ebc8259b5a4 --- /dev/null +++ b/devel/linux-rl9-strace/pkg-plist.amd64 @@ -0,0 +1,11 @@ +usr/bin/strace +usr/bin/strace-log-merge +usr/lib/.build-id/e8/df21c76b8689e5542f3dfb6bae1425626ed342 +usr/share/man/man1/strace-log-merge.1.gz +usr/share/man/man1/strace.1.gz +%%PORTDOCS%%%%DOCSDIR%%/COPYING +%%PORTDOCS%%%%DOCSDIR%%/CREDITS +%%PORTDOCS%%%%DOCSDIR%%/ChangeLog-CVS.gz +%%PORTDOCS%%%%DOCSDIR%%/ChangeLog.gz +%%PORTDOCS%%%%DOCSDIR%%/NEWS +%%PORTDOCS%%%%DOCSDIR%%/README